Trabalho

Disponível somente no TrabalhosFeitos
  • Páginas : 9 (2138 palavras )
  • Download(s) : 0
  • Publicado : 15 de fevereiro de 2013
Ler documento completo
Amostra do texto
Universidade Federal Ceará

Registradores de Deslocamento e Contadores
Eletrônica Digital Professor: Rômulo Nunes David Melo Junior Prado Júlio Cézar Arteiro Frota Alinsson Souza Graduandos em Engenharia da Computação

Registradores de Deslocamento
• Conjunto de registradores – Configurados de forma linear – Deslocamento depende da configuração

• Tipos de combinação – Combinações deentrada e saída: serial ou paralela

Para que servem ?
• Construídos por flip-flops • Armazenam informações binárias

• Realizam conversão de dados (Série - Paralelo)
• Operações aritméticas

Possíveis combinações
• Serial-in -> Serial-out • Parallel-in -> Serial-out

• Serial-in -> Parallel-out
• Parallel-in -> Parallel-out

Deslocamento dos bits
• Shift-Right • Shift-Left Deslocamento para a direita

Figura 01 – Circuito de deslocamento para direita.

Deslocamento Genérico

Figura 02 – Circuito de deslocamento genérico de 4 bits.

Deslocamento em Anel

Figura 03 – Circuito de deslocamento em anel de 4 bits.

Conversor serial-paralelo
• Consiste em um conjunto de flip-flop ’s(Tipo FD ou Jk), em que a informação que chega em serie pela entrada e édistribuída, a cada pulso de clock, para os outros flip-flop ’s, convertendo em dados paralelos.

Esquemático usando o flip-flop(D)

Esquemático usando o flip-flop(D)

Esquemático usando o flip-flop(D)

Figura 04. Registrador de deslocamento serial-paralelo.

Exemplo
• Queremos inserir a palavra “1001” em serie e converter seu sinal para paralelo.

Exemplo
• Queremos inserir a palavra“1001” em serie e converter seu sinal para paralelo.

Figura 05. Registrador de deslocamento serial-paralelo.

Exemplo
• Queremos inserir a palavra “1001” em serie e converter seu sinal para paralelo.
Clk
0

D
1

A0
0

A1
0

A2
0

A3
0

Figura 05. Registrador de deslocamento serial-paralelo.

Exemplo
• Queremos inserir a palavra “1001” em serie e converter seu sinal paraparalelo.
Clk
0

D
1

A0
0

A1
0

A2
0

A3
0

1

0

1

0

0

0

Figura 05. Registrador de deslocamento serial-paralelo.

Exemplo
• Queremos inserir a palavra “1001” em serie e converter seu sinal para paralelo.
Clk
0

D
1

A0
0

A1
0

A2
0

A3
0

1

0

1

0

0

0

Figura 05. Registrador de deslocamento serial-paralelo.

Exemplo• Queremos inserir a palavra “1001” em serie e converter seu sinal para paralelo.
Clk
0

D
1

A0
0

A1
0

A2
0

A3
0

1
1 Figura 05. Registrador de deslocamento serial-paralelo.

0
0

1
0

0
1

0
0

0
0

Exemplo
• Queremos inserir a palavra “1001” em serie e converter seu sinal para paralelo.
Clk
0

D
1

A0
0

A1
0

A2
0

A3
0

1
1

00

1
0

0
1

0
0

0
0

1
Figura 05. Registrador de deslocamento serial-paralelo.

1

0

0

1

0

Exemplo
• Queremos inserir a palavra “1001” em serie e converter seu sinal para paralelo.
Clk
0

D
1

A0
0

A1
0

A2
0

A3
0

1
1

0
0

1
0

0
1

0
0

0
0

1
Figura 05. Registrador de deslocamento serial-paralelo.

1

0

0

10

Exemplo
• Queremos inserir a palavra “1001” em serie e converter seu sinal para paralelo.
Clk
0

D
1

A0
0

A1
0

A2
0

A3
0

1
1

0
0

1
0

0
1

0
0

0
0

1
Figura 05. Registrador de deslocamento serial-paralelo. 1

1
0

0
1

0
0

1
0

0
1

Exemplo
• Queremos inserir a palavra “1001” em serie e converter seu sinal para paralelo.Clk
0

D
1

A0
0

A1
0

A2
0

A3
0

1
1

0
0

1
0

0
1

0
0

0
0

1
Figura 05. Registrador de deslocamento serial-paralelo. 1

1
0

0
1

0
0

1
0

0
1

Utilizações, vantagens e desvantagem
• Conversores serie-paralelo são usados com frequência em contadores;

• Modulador e demulador;
• SIPO;

• Diminuem o volume do circuito; • Mais...
tracking img